Rider to Rider Communication

 I bought an adventure bike to explore off-road.  I also bought a helmet intercom system from Sena (actually mine if branded HJC but it made by Sena, it is an HJC 10B).  I rode with some friends that also have helmet intercoms.  This is really grate, pretty much a necessity once you have had it.  There is no going back.  You can hold a conversation while riding.  The front person can also warn the people behind of upcoming obstacles, vehicles, hazards, etc.  

The two leading helmet communications makers are Sena and Cardo.  These 2 both have mesh systems which allows the communications to use multiple riders to relay messages across the group.  This also allows for larger groups of riders to all communicate at the same time.  These 2 mesh systems are not compatible though (although Cardo now offers a bridge feature).  This mesh approach is great for street riders who ride close together.  However, off-road the mesh approach has some issues.  Off-road we have things like dust, gravel, and rocks getting kicked up by the tires, narrow trails, and other issues that make us ride much farther apart.  We also have hills, canyons, mountains, and other obstacles that interrupt the communications.  If the person in the back drops their bike, communication is lost pretty fast as the other riders increase the distance.  Just when you need it most you lose communications.

I looked into these options and decided to go with the BTech GMRS-Pro and the push to talk (PTT) button.  This works slick with my HJC/Sena helmet system (and likely most others).  It pairs to the helmet intercom as a second phone.  This way you can still use the intercom via Bluetooth as normal until you are too far away and the intercom drops.  Then you simply use the PTT button to contact the other riders.  If and when you get back in intercom range you can switch back.  Switching back and forth is automatic really.  The intercom is much preferred as it allows continuous 2-way communication and is lower power (less radiation). I prefer to use the radio only when needed (which happens on many rides).  This BTech is really the only GMRS radio with Bluetooth profiles to support this configuration.  I found others that support Bluetooth for app integration but this device also supports profiles for hands free communication and the PTT remote. This radio is also waterproof making it a good choice.






This radio is a 5 Watt unit which is not something you want too close to electronics or your body really.  I don't really need to see or touch the radio when riding since I have the PYY button and the mic and speakers use the helmet intercom system.  I set the channel and volume and forget it.  I decided to clip it into my rear pack, as far from me as I can.  I zip the pack on the clip which retains it very well.  The radio is waterproof so no worries there.   

That all seemed like a great idea until we tried it while riding.  The PTT button would only work sometimes, maybe half the time.  I suspect the EMI from the motorcycles ignition system interfered with the Bluetooth signal from the PTT button.  I decided it was time to mount the radio on the handlebars.  I made a mount on the left side which is also only a few inches between the PTT button and the radio.






I found that having the PTT button on the grip was a problem since it would sometimes get in the way of the clutch level.  I moved it to the mirror mount using a strip of Velcro tape and the strap it came with to keep it in position.
This worked OK but you have to reach for it and it can slide along the strap a bit.  I finally moved it to the clutch lever.

Look closely and you can see one zip tie on each side of the clutch adjuster so it can't move at all.

I used 2 small zip ties to retain it in place. Now I can use my index finger to press the button while riding without having to reach.  It is also in a place where I would never hit it by accident and it does not move at all.


The GMRS radio can also communicate with FRS and Ham radios.  This means others can have an array of different radios and they can all work together.  You just have to chose the same channel.  FRS channels 1 - 7 appear to be the best choice for compatibility with both FRS and GMRS at 5W.  Channels 8 - 14 are limited to 0.5W so not great for our purposes.  Channels 15 - 22 would also be good as GMRS can go to 50W here but because of that high power capability you might pick of many other radios that are very far away.  

Here is how I setup my system.
  1. Pair the BTech radio to your phone via Bluetooth.  This is used to simplify configuration, not communication really. The Btech app uses this connection to communicate with the radio so the app can be used.  Follow the instructions in the app.  
  2. Pair the BTech radio to the push to talk (PTT) button.  Follow the directions that come with the radio and PTT button.
  3. Pair the BTech radio to your helmet intercom via Bluetooth setting it as a second phone.  Follow the instructions for putting the radio in paring mode.  Then put the helmet intercom in pairing mode to pair to a phone.  Treat the radio as a 2nd phone in this case. With HJC/Sena you enter the configuration menu using the helmet intercom buttons until you hear "pair second phone".
